If you are convicted of a hit-and-run accident that only resulted in property damage (no injuries or deaths), six points will be added to your driving record. (Six is the largest number of points you can earn for a single violation.) If occupied vehicles were damaged, you will also be fined between $100 and $5,000, sentenced to jail for up to one year, or both. [License Suspension; Keeping Your License; South Carolina Driver's Manual], [SC Code § 56-5-1220]
